Background and Player Profile

Milos Kerkez, aged 21, is a left-back currently playing for Bournemouth in the Premier League. His performances have attracted interest from top clubs, with Liverpool emerging as a leading contender for his signature. The transfer is part of Liverpool’s long-term planning for the left side of their defense, considering the age and contract situation of current left-backs Andy Robertson (31, contract until 2026) and potential exit of Kostas Tsimikas.

Transfer Negotiations and Financial Details

Recent reports indicate that personal terms between Kerkez and Liverpool have been agreed, with a contract potentially ready until 2030. The transfer fee is estimated at around £45 million, though Bournemouth is reportedly asking for 45-50 million. Fabrizio Romano, a trusted transfer journalist, has confirmed that an agreement is done with the player, and the contract is ready, with Kerkez eager to join. However, negotiations between the clubs are ongoing, with some gaps in valuation, though talks are progressing positively.

Multiple sources, including news outlets and X posts, suggest that a verbal agreement may have been reached, with some even claiming Kerkez has been given permission to undergo a medical. Despite this, the deal is not yet officially finalized, leaving room for potential delays or changes.

Player’s Perspective and Public Statements

Kerkez has addressed the transfer speculation in an interview with MLSZ TV, expressing that he is humbled by the interest from Liverpool and other Premier League clubs. He sees the rumors as motivation to improve further, rather than something that boosts his ego, teaching him humility. Additionally, his friendship with Dominik Szoboszlai, Liverpool’s midfielder and Hungary captain, is noted as a factor that could help his adaptation if he joins the club. An X post highlighted an Instagram message from Kerkez saying, “I don’t know what will happen in [the] next week but Cherries family thank you!” which suggests he is aware of the impending move but remains grateful to Bournemouth.

Timeline and Recent Developments

The interest in Kerkez started with preliminary talks in November 2024, as confirmed by an X post from @HunFootballXtra, with Liverpool asking Bournemouth for permission to negotiate. By April 19, 2025, @JamesWillliam_ reported that Kerkez was set to agree personal terms, and by May 19, 2025, @JamesWathland and @NicoSchira indicated a full verbal agreement was reached, with minor details left. Given the recency of these updates, it seems likely that the transfer is in its final stages as of June 1, 2025, though official confirmation is pending.

Strategic Context for Liverpool

Liverpool’s pursuit of Kerkez aligns with their strategy for succession planning at left-back. Andy Robertson, at 31, has a contract until 2026, and there are rumors of Kostas Tsimikas potentially leaving, creating a need for a long-term option. Kerkez’s youth and potential make him a suitable candidate, and his addition could strengthen Liverpool’s defensive line for future seasons.
